"GOSPEL FLAVA.COM"

With over 25 years in music ministry and nearly 200 songs to her credit, Freda Battle is no stranger at all. The prolific Boston native now adds to her credit her second release with her choral aggregation The Temple Worshippers, titled Here Is Our Praise.

This Axiom Records release is the follow-up to the group’s impressive 2002 release, Serious Praise.

Without question, praise and worship afficionadoes will quickly be drawn to this project, as the 13-track effort is one of the strongest offerings of the year. Penning nine of the thirteen tracks, Battle displays her heart for worship with an infectious set of material that will both encourage the believer and create an authentic atmosphere for worship to the Father.

Battle enlists the assistance of Israel Houghton’s production, who himself is arguably the most noticeable praise and worship leader of the last five years. Houghton produces the lion’s share of the project, handling duties for ten of the thirteen songs. In addition, he joins April Thompson on lead vocals to the terrifically encouraging “I Know The Plans“, based on Jeremiah 29:11.

Continuing a strong scriptural vibe, check out “Over and Over Again”, with its incredibly infectious hook (based on a text from Ephesians 3). Longtime Commissioned contributor Parkes Stewart makes a guest appearance on “Right At Home/I Love”, showing that he can hang with the best in the praise and worship field.

Guaranteed hits include “Sing For Joy” (featuring the always wonderful Daniel Johnson), “Psalm 47”, “How Great is Our God” and the formidable title track that latches into your musical memory and won’t let go. Clarence “Tank” Powell takes the mic on Psalm 47, and also on “And Praise”, together with Battle.

The diversity on this effort is undeniable and will lock you in for an impacting and powerful 70-plus minute ride that will take your devotion period to a new level. Simply put, Battle and the Temple Worshippers have a sure fire hit on their hands.

"GOSPEL CITY.COM"

For over 25 years, Freda Battle has always focused her mind on the battlefield. With a bunch of goals on her plate, it’s not hard to fathom that she has only one recorded project to this day, the much-heralded Serious Praise from 2002. Now teamed with highly-respected producer/musician, Israel Houghton, Here Is Our Praise features Battle with The Temple Worshippers (TW), blending both Battle originals and four established praise favorites.

Here are a few highlights of Battle’s journey: the Boston native has invested almost three decades with the National Convention of Gospel Choirs and Choruses, founded by gospel pioneer Thomas Dorsey, plus serves as Minister of Jubilee Christian Church, the home-base for Axiom Records. What very few music ministers accomplish is eight years of gospel announcing, including a stint on Boston's R&B station, WILD. The program fits her gifts: “Freda Battle On The Battlefield”. She has also been one of the main cornerstones in the greater Boston area, teaching and exhorting others in worship and Biblical principles behind the music. More recently, labelmate Bobby Perry & R.A.I.N. joined The Temple Worshippers and Battle for the annual Urban Impact Summit in Connecticut and the Chicago (Ill.) Gospelfest.

The joy sways through the air on Sing For Joy, (recorded by worship leader Don Moen) as we lean on Him for refuge: “If we call to Him, He will answer.” Some Earth Wind & Fire vibes amplify a soul-stopping vocal by Israel & New Breed’s Daniel Johnson.

It would indeed take eternity to show gratitude for For All You’ve Done For Me. Kerry Strong and Ellis Littles bounce their voices off TW. The slightly unconventional but refreshing ending catches the gang giving thanks to collard greens, cornbread and the rest of the meal. Glorious noises hover around the title track, a cleverly arranged piece where the vocals instill the perfect atmosphere without any overdrive. Everyday, from Hillsongs Worship’s Joel Houston, is a smooth groove and Neville Diedericks fills the lead spot.

or the movers and shakers in the Kingdom, Worshippers & Warriors (Battle cites 2 Chronicles 20 as an example) feds off the enemies’ intent: “We’re breaking the curse over our lives.” Many congregations have recently embraced How Great Is Our God, co-penned by Chris Tomlin. Reaching way back into the hymn archives, the bridge incorporates How Great Thou Art.

Starting out in a pensive mode, Over & Over Again spills over into a wonderful profession of His Greatness: “the width, the length, the height, the depth.” Clarence Powell, a soloist on Serious Praise, briefly stops by for Psalms 47 (God Has Ascended), delivery effortless vocal fills.

Hallelu runs on a soft Latin foundation, remaining quiet in nature, touched up with adlib praises at the finish. Israel finally steps to the mic with April Thompson in a well?attuned duet, I Know Your Plans, derived from Jeremiah 29:11.

Sending a fluid 80s/90s R&B vibe, (and shades of Sam Cooke), Parkes Stewart’s heart for worship is truly evident on Right At Home/I Love. After the anthem-like Hear All Ye People, And Praise sets the precedent as Powell, Battle and company welcome in “the new heaven and earth where sin will be no more”.

Not diverting credit from Isaiah’s production for Here Is Our Praise but both this and Serious Praise dish up a precious contemporary vibe without the high-tech trappings. TW, along with guest vocalists New Breed, sail along with moving solos and choral harmonies. Battle always maintains a maturity when lending her leadership or warm alto vocals. The battlefield will always be ripe as long as Freda Battle leads the praise forces.

"NUTHINBUTGOSPEL.COM"

One look at Freda Battle's resume will tell you that she's no stranger to the gospel music industry. Even though "Here is Our Praise" is her 2nd national release with the Temple Worshippers on Axiom Records, Freda has been recording and leading worship for quite a while.

Pairing up with Israel Houghton on the production end of things on this endeavor, she has churned out quite a project this time around. Here Is Our Praise is quite Sunday morning friendly. Not only will you find choir music here, but music for smaller worship teams is featured as well...but then that's to be expected with Battle and Houghton at the helm. Battle and her trademark exhortations shine through on several tracks -- but don't miss the soloists featured on this project. Houghton steps from behind the scenes and into the spotlight on the reassuring track I Know The Plans.

Bio

Stellar production and songwriting join forces in "Here Is Our Praise", the sophomore release from Freda Battle & the Temple Worshippers on Axiom Records. Freda transitioned from a regional artist to a national artist with her debut release, "Serious Praise" in 2002, which garnered her a 2003 GMWA Excellence Award nomination for Contemporary Choir of the Year. She is now preparing to go global with her collaboration with internationally recognized Grammy, Dove, Stellar, and Soul Train Award winning artist & producer, Israel Houghton, on her latest offering.

Featuring thirteen tracks that are poised to redefine the worship experience, "Here Is Our Praise" was dubbed one of the most highly anticipated releases of 2006 and "The Strongest Album of the Year" by gospelflava.com.

Battle is well known throughout the gospel industry after 25 years as a songwriter and worship leader working and/or writing for such artists such as Donald Lawrence, Shirley Ceasar, Jennifer Hollliday, The Winans, Commisioned, Vanessa Bell-Armstrong, with writing credits including award-winning female trio Witness, GMWA Mass Choir Live In Milwaukee, National Convention of Gospel Choirs and Choruses, Clarence Powell, Here II Praise, As One, and her choral aggregation The Temple Worshippers amongst others. .
